✦ Synopsis


relaxation times (1 Is) of cryptands [2.1.1], [2.2.1] and [2.2.2] as well as those of the corresponding crypeate complexes with Li+, Na+, and K+ in CDCl and CH OH:D 0 (9O:lO) were measured and the results are interpreted in terms of molesular co oreszion % and desolvation effects.
